Re: Wish-List for Dominions 4
1) Custom forging. Allow players to improve ordinary or magical equipment by selecting from a broad range of existing traits. For example, I could add "luck" to an item - but it would be more expensive than forging a luck pendent. Maybe S3, instead of the S1 that a pendent requires. Also perhaps a chance of failure.
2) Prevent tiny suicide armies from being able to pin down much larger armies. I've been frustrated by AI attacking me with 11 suicidal militia, but in doing so holding up a 200-unit army for an entire turn. I think that if an army takes less than 5% casualties, it should be allowed to continue with a plotted move rather than held up for the turn.
3) Better controls for battle replays - give us rewind and fast forward buttons. I frequently find myself wanting to go back a few frames for a closer look at something, but having to replay the whole battle to do that.
4) Related point - have an event-by-event log for battles that one has the option to view. ie, click on "battle log" and you get a blow-by-blow text description of everything that happened.
5) Better info on dominion changes. I would love to be able to see via map shading where dominion has changed over the previous turn, and/or last 5 turns. ie, "red" provinces are where I lost dominion, "green" are where I gained, with darkness indicating the degree of change.
6) spells that affect the dominion contest. for example, an air spell that spread the voice of your god, increasing the effectiveness of your temple checks by 20% for that turn. Or a death spell that reduces enemy dominion in a province you own by 3 steps, at the cost of unrest and population loss. You get the idea...
7) Better audio cues for what's happening in a battle. I'd love a different sound for attacks that miss completely, attacks that are blocked by shield, attacks that hit but cause no damage due to protection, and attacks that hit and cause damage.
8) Ability to see # kills for any unit, not just those in the Hall of Fame.
9) Better spell control and AI - some of the options canvassed in this thread are good. I want my Black Dryads to cast Banish on enemy undead, not summon pitiful skeletons!
10) More statistics - per turn and lifetime kills, points of damage inflicted, casualties taken, kill ratio, gems collected and spent, etc etc. I love seeing this info!
11) At end of game, ability to review the game in various ways - ie, replay key battles, view a map-based movie of the expansion and contraction of dominion and ownership of various nations, etc. I used to love this feature of "Warlords II", that old SSG classic!
12) Ability to revert to earlier versions of a saved game, rather than always playing "hardcore" mode. Of course, "hardcore" is the only real option for MP, but I play single player mostly, and would like the ability to reload if I've misclicked or forgotten something really important.
13) Even more nations! I love how most existing nations are inspired by actual human mythology. Some cultures with very rich traditions that don't yet have a Dom3 nation include: Indigenous australian, melanesian, polynesian, inuit, North American indian.
14) Much more diversity in random events and magic sites. The existing usual random events (unrest, gems, etc) get quite boring after a while.
15) A really s***-hot online support site, incorporating an officially supported wiki but also with downloads, maps, mods, etc... A forum is generally not the best way to present all of this information!
